How Our Commercial Water Damage Restoration Process Works
Our team’s process for Commercial Water Damage Restoration is designed to get your business back up and running quickly. We understand the importance of a proper process, as cutting corners can lead to further damage and costly repairs. Our experienced technicians follow a proven step-by-step approach to ensure a thorough and efficient restoration. Here’s an overview of what you can expect:
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team will arrive on-site to assess the damage and create a customized plan to restore your property.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ect hidden water damage and identify the source of the issue. This step is crucial in determining the scope of work and preventing further damage.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using powerful pumps and vacuums, our technicians will extract the standing water from your property. This step is critical in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th. Our team will work efficiently to reduce downtime and get your business back up and running.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water has been extracted, our team will use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the affected area. This step is essential in preventing mold growth and ensuring a thorough restoration. Our technicians will work closely with you to ensure the drying process is completed to your satisfaction.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
After the drying process is complete, our team will clean and sanitize the affected area to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ria. This step is crucial in ensuring a safe and healthy environment for your employees and customers.
Step 5: Reconstruction and Repair
Once the cleaning and sanitizing process is complete, our team will work with you to reconstruct and repair any damaged areas. This step may include replacing drywall, flooring, and other materials. Our technicians will work closely with you to ensure the final result meets your expectations.

Warning Signs You Need Commercial Water Damage Restoration
Early detection is key in preventing further damage and costly repairs. Here are some warning signs you shouldn’t ignore: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a persistent musty smell in your building, it may be a sign of hidden water damage. Don’t ignore this warning sign, it could lead to mold growth and further damage.
Water Stains on Ceilings and Walls
Water stains on ceilings and walls can be a sign of a larger issue. If left unchecked, these stains can lead to costly repairs and even structural damage.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age beneath the surface. Don’t wait, address this iss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or high humidity. Address this issue qu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.
Unusual Sounds or Leaks
Unusual sounds or leaks can be a sign of a larger issue. Don’t ignore this warning sign, it could lead to costly repairs and even safety hazards.
Visible Water Damage or Leaks
Visible water damage or leaks are a clear sign that you need Commercial Water Damage Restoration. Don’t wait, address this issue qu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.

Commercial Water Damage Restoration Cost In Friant, CA
The cost of Commercial Water Damage Rest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Friant, CA. These estimates are based on average costs and may not reflect the actual price for your specific situation. Our team will provide a customized estimate after assessing the damage and creating a plan for restoration.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and time required |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and time required |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$1,500 – $6,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and time required |
| Reconstruction and Repair | $3,000 – $15,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ials used, and time required |
| Emergency Services (after hours or weekends) | 10% – 20% of total cost | Time of day, day of the week, and urgency of the situation |
| More Services (e.g., mold remediation or structural repair) | $1,000 – $10,000 | Scope of work, materials used, and time required |
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and may vary based on the specifics of your situation.
